Walmart Marketplace Announces New Features for Sellers

Walmart unveiled several initiatives to thousands of sellers attending Let’s Grow! 2024 Walmart Marketplace Seller Summit, including category expansion and multichannel fulfilment.

Walmart Marketplace continues to invest in capabilities and solutions to fuel seller success and offer customers an endless aisle of items they need, want and love.

“We’re executing strategic priorities at Walmart that are helping us to become the customers’ first choice – every day, every season, for every item. Walmart Marketplace is a key component of that mission,” said Tom Ward, Executive Vice President And Chief Ecommerce Officer, Walmart US. 

“We know the importance of personalised, seamless omnichannel experiences, and Walmart continues to advance its digital and fulfilment capabilities, including the new categories and features we announced today, that enhance the overall customer and seller experience on Walmart.com.”

Walmart Marketplace has achieved more than 30% sales growth in each of the past four quarters and is significantly driving the retailer’s sustained ecommerce success. 

Walmart’s global eCommerce sales surpassed $100 billion last year, and its US ecommerce business has delivered double digit growth for six consecutive quarters. 

The sustained momentum stems from innovative customer experiences and an omnichannel assortment that is increasing as more independent sellers choose Walmart as a smart path for growth. The number of sellers listing items on Walmart.com grew 20% last fiscal year.

Premium Beauty, pre-owned and collectibles 

To offer more selection for customers and more opportunities for sellers, Walmart is growing its Marketplace assortment by adding Premium Beauty and expanding its range of Collectibles and pre-owned merchandise.

  • Premium Beauty: Walmart is launching Premium Beauty on Walmart Marketplace through a new online experience. More than 20 new brands, including COSRX, T3 and Beachwaver, are featured in the initial assortment of skin care, hair care and hair tool products. Backed by custom storefronts and editorial content, Premium Beauty at Walmart creates an elevated, seamless brand experience. 
  • Pre-Owned: Walmart Marketplace is introducing Resold at Walmart, its first digital destination for cross-category and cross-condition pre-owned items from performance-managed sellers. With five million items from more than 1,700 sellers, the integrated assortment offers customers a growing selection of goods from luxury fashion and electronics to collectibles, sporting goods and more at the value they expect from Walmart. By extending the life of these products, Resold at Walmart aligns with our commitment to make the more sustainable choice the everyday choice and builds on the success of Walmart Restored, a collection of refurbished electronics and small appliances powered by Walmart Marketplace.

  • Collectibles: Walmart is enriching experiences for collectors, bringing customers new ways to secure highly sought after collectibles and connecting sellers to the rapidly growing market of enthusiasts shopping its aisles. In the Collector shop, sellers can now enable preorders to build customer anticipation for drops, including releases exclusive to Walmart. The experience adds pre-owned conditions for collectibles under Resold at Walmart. 

Unboxing new fulfilment solutions

Walmart continues to leverage its next-generation supply chain and advanced technology to simplify and streamline fulfilment for sellers at some of the lowest rates in the industry. Walmart Fulfilment Services (WFS) is announcing new ways for sellers to quickly move merchandise across markets and use Walmart to fulfil any eCommerce retail order.

  • Multichannel Logistics: Walmart’s new Multichannel Solutions program allows sellers to use WFS to fulfil orders from any eCommerce site via Walmart’s supply chain. Walmart will fulfil orders and manage returns while offering plain, unbranded packaging, fast, reliable shipping and competitive rates averaging 15% lower than the competition. Walmart is launching the program on 10 September, in time for Holiday deliveries.

  • Cross Border Fulfilment: Through its new Walmart Cross Border import service for full-container-load shipments, WFS can now handle transportation of inbound goods from ports of origin in Asia directly to WFS facilities across the US. 

Walmart is also opening its carrier network to sellers for full truckload shipments. Sellers using the Walmart Preferred Carrier program through WFS can now choose to ship a few items or an entire truckload at special rates through carriers vetted by Walmart.  

Heading into Holiday with new seller solutions

Walmart is enabling several solutions and perks for sellers to support their Holiday readiness. Last year, Walmart Marketplace achieved its two biggest sales days ever during the Holiday selling season as millions of customers shopped Walmart.com. The investments and hundreds of enhancements shaped by listening to sellers include: 

  • A reimagined Global Seller Center and new app provide seamless onboarding for eligible sellers in any market, so they can cross borders and go global by selling in the US, Mexico, Chile and Canada. Sellers attending Let’s Grow! 2024 will be the first to access the new cross-listing capability and free translations.

  • Walmart is waiving peak season storage fees for sellers who inbound their inventory to WFS fulfilment centres through 30 September. Sellers are encouraged to send their inventory as early as possible to meet customer demand for Holiday deal shopping and Walmart events.

  • To help sellers scale their Holiday business, Walmart Marketplace Capital is expanding to offer qualified sellers access to cash advances. This can be up to $5 million for any qualifying seller.

  • Walmart is now rolling out a new Deals Dashboard that makes it easy for sellers to enrol items in Walmart’s popular deals events. The feature also provides sellers more data and insights to improve the quality of offers and make more deals available to customers during Holiday.  

“Sellers are looking for a smart path for growth,” said Manish Joneja, Senior Vice President, Walmart Marketplace and Walmart Fulfilment Services. “We’re bringing all the pieces together to be much more than a marketplace and investing in new ways for sellers to serve customers as we grow together.”
